A humble person does not flaunt their wealth, status, accomplishments, or anything else they may have. They are modest and often embarrassed by praise. Instead of being proud of themselves, a humble person will be happy for others who deserve the credit.How do you compliment someone who is a good person?

How do you respond to a humbly compliment?
Do say 'thank you'. The rule of thumb when you receive a compliment is to simply and humbly say “Thank you” or “Thank you; I appreciate your kind words.” By accepting the compliment, you show gratitude for the other person's kind remarks and do not come off as vain, bashful or prideful.What is a better word than humble?
